The Need

Circular Plastics Australia required a wastewater treatment plant that would allow for expansion of the recycling facility in the future.

The system needed to ensure an odour-free end product and ensure sustainable and efficient operations.

The solution

Aerofloat installed its circular dissolved air flotation unit, the AeroCircDAF, to treat higher flow volumes of wash water if needed as the facility grows.

It also included its fully automated, intelligent PLC control system to accommodate the integration of additional Aerofloat technology as the business expands.

The benefit

Aerofloat’s partnership with Circular Plastics Australia ensured compliant wastewater that can be reused as wash water within the recycling plant, helping to reduce the company’s footprint further with significant savings on water usage.

Aerofloat ensured clean wash water and sustainable operations for Circular Plastics Australia

Located in Albury-Wodonga, the Circular Plastics facility is a joint venture between Asahi Beverages, Pact Group Holdings Ltd and Cleanaway Waste Management Ltd. Australian company Aerofloat was contracted to design and construct the wastewater treatment system for the project to ensure clean, reusable wash water within the plant and a sustainable end-product.

The project heralds the third venture that Astron Sustainability, a subsidiary of Pact Group, and Aerofloat has worked on together.

Aerofloat’s design ensured a sustainable, long-term solution for Circular Plastics. Clean wastewater from the system is either re-used as wash water within the plastics recycling facility or discharged to sewer.  Aerofloat worked closely with the local council to ensure its strict policies and guidelines around managing microplastics in its inland waterways are met.
